Output de56bb3f0fbeebec0cb52f183513f0d86658ff747d69c518d9d2deec70b77b17:27

value
154219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9df4575432c851129d687e1c5c914b897e9efb2 OP_EQUAL
address
3QUDeUNtyrP5ahk1jb2d4URK1tjJvWJzQz
transaction
de56bb3f0fbeebec0cb52f183513f0d86658ff747d69c518d9d2deec70b77b17
confirmations
237161
spent
true